Realty's unscrupulous reality

The collapse of a 13-storey building in Shanghai's Minhang district last week has sent shivers down the spines of homeowners as well as potential buyers, who have either spent or are ready to spend their life savings on a dream house.

Worries of daily life have haunted us for long. Right from rocketing property costs to contaminated foodstuff to unforeseen tragedies - the latest being the Chengdu bus blaze that killed 27 people, and not to forget the Chenzhou train collision.

If that wasn't already enough now we have to worry about our houses dropping to the ground.
